Title: how do you use ogg vorbis
Post by: NJIN on September 05, 2011, 12:38:15 PM
i have no idea how to add the ogg files for music any help would be appreciated  ???
Title: Re: how do you use ogg vorbis
Post by: ViciouZ on September 05, 2011, 01:50:55 PM
1. Acquire ogg files
2. Make a folder in "pball" called "music"
3. Put ogg files in music folder

now they are playing but they sound speeded up
Title: Re: how do you use ogg vorbis
Post by: ViciouZ on June 04, 2012, 06:13:46 PM
i think that you might have to use constant bitrate files or that might happen. alternatively, don't use the OGG system and we can just remove it and spare people the trouble
Title: Re: how do you use ogg vorbis
Post by: jitspoe on June 05, 2012, 02:00:23 PM
I'm not sure if the ogg gets resampled.  The issue might be that the game runs sound at 48khz and most music is done at 44khz.  Having ogg support isn't a bad thing -- I might use it for in-game menu music or something, but you might as well just run a media player in the background if you just want to play music while the game is running.
